What is the online signature legality for logistics in European Union
The online signature legality for logistics in the European Union refers to the legal framework that governs the use of electronic signatures within the logistics sector. This framework is primarily established by the eIDAS Regulation, which stands for electronic IDentification, Authentication and trust Services. Under this regulation, electronic signatures are recognized as legally binding, provided they meet specific criteria. This ensures that documents signed electronically in the logistics industry are valid and enforceable, similar to traditional handwritten signatures.

Legal use of the online signature legality for logistics in European Union
The legal use of online signatures in the logistics sector within the European Union is governed by the eIDAS Regulation, which establishes the validity of electronic signatures. For a signature to be legally recognized, it must be created using a secure method that ensures the signer's identity and consent. This includes using advanced electronic signatures or qualified electronic signatures, which provide a higher level of security and legal assurance. Businesses must ensure compliance with these standards to avoid disputes and ensure the enforceability of their logistics documents.

Documents You Can Sign
In the logistics sector, various documents can be signed electronically, including:
- Shipping contracts
- Bill of lading
- Customs declarations
- Delivery receipts
- Logistics service agreements
These documents benefit from the efficiency and security of electronic signatures, ensuring a streamlined workflow while maintaining legal compliance.
